A recent Consumers Report had a study of printers and included
price-per-prints. The differences are dramatic. With b/w, the cheapest
is like 1/4 of the highest. In color, the cheapest (but still
highly-rated) was less than half the highest. Once people see this they
will shun the come-on prices of some printers. Hope you have chosen your
printers on this basis and price fairly.
